Title :
Space charge due to contact effects in Al-polyethylene terephthalate-Al systems: modeling and study by the thermally stimulated current method

Abstract :
The Thermally Stimulated Depolarization Current method allowed us to emphasize the role played by aluminum-polyester contacts on the electrical properties of Metal-Polyethylene Terephthalate films-Metal systems. Assuming the existence of Schottky barriers at the Al-PET interfaces after heat treatment, the electronic band model permitted us to account for the nature and properties of the space charge in annealed PET films (1.5 to 12 μm), in a wide range of poling temperatures, times and fields
